Having been run as the Diamond Jubilee Stakes and the Platinum Jubilee Stakes in recent seasons, the final Group One at Royal Ascot has been renamed in memory of Queen Elizabeth II, who passed away in 2022. This six-furlong contest always attracts a high-quality field and top sprinters from around the world will contest this year's race.

2026 Queen Elizabeth II Jubilee Stakes Entries
Chris Waller's mare Joliestar leads the way in the Royal Ascot betting. A five-time Group One winner in her homeland, Joliestar is also entered in the King Charles III Stakes on the opener day of the meeting, and could attempt an audacious double when she makes her British debut.
Satono Reve was narrowly beaten by the excellent Lazzat in this race 12 months ago, and returns to Ascot on the back of a Group One triumph at Chukyo in March. Japan could also be represented by Lugal, who was last seen finished a close second behind Native Approach in the Al Quoz Sprint at Meydan.
Commanche Brave took his form to a new level when landing the Greenlands Stakes, and Donnacha O'Brien's four-year-old is fancied to run another huge race. Andre Fabre's Prix Maurice de Gheest winner Sajir also sits prominently in the market. Listed winner Flora Of Bermuda, and former Champion Sprinter Kind Of Blue could represent Wathnan Racing.
Lake Forest is entered in the Queen Anne Stakes, but seems much more likely to drop back down to six furlongs. Like Joliestar, Overpass is entered in both Group One sprints at Royal Ascot. Double Rush, Almeraq, Aramram and Big Mojo could also take their chance in the final Group One of the meeting.
